Abstract
In this study, 17 kinds of polyphenols and 5 kinds of anthocyanins were analyzed to compare the contents of polyphenols and anthocyanins in 76 colored agricultural products. A total of 17 polyphenols were analyzed simultaneously by 9 phenolic acids (gallic acid, protocatechuic acid, chlorogenic acid, vanillic acid, caffeic acid, syringic acid, p-coumaric acid, t-ferulic acid, t-cinnamic acid) and 8 flavonoids ((+)catechin, syringic aldehyde, rutin, epicatechin gallate, naringin, luteolin, naringenin, kaempferol) and 5 anthocyanins (delphinidin-3-glucoside, delphinidin- 3-rutinoside, cyanidin-3-galactoside, cyanidin-3-glucoside, cyanidin-3-arabinoside) were simultaneously analyzed. The total content of 17 polyphenols was determined as seoritae 255.1 ¡¾ 7.5 ¥ìg/g, seomoktae 275.8 ¡¾ 5.3 ¥ìg/g, black rice 78.5 ¡¾ 4.6 ¥ìg/g, black sesame 75.8 ¡¾ 3.2 ¥ìg/g, blueberry 143.3 ¡¾ 5.5 ¥ìg/g, aronia 195.2 ¡¾ 4.9 ¥ìg/g and blackcurrent 131.6 ¡¾ 3.2 ¥ìg/g, the highest content was found in the order of seomoktae > seoritae > aronia > blueberry > blackcurrant > black rice > black sesame. The total content of 5 anthocyanins was determined as seoritae 82.4 ¡¾ 17.2 ¥ìg/g, seomoktae 95.2 ¡¾ 6.1 ¥ìg/g, black rice 74.1 ¡¾ 9.7 ¥ìg/g, black sesame were not detected, blueberry 110.8 ¡¾ 1.9 ¥ìg/g, aronia 218.9 ¡¾ 6.1 ¥ìg/g and blackcurrent 209.7 ¡¾ 4.0 ¥ìg/g, the highest content was found in the order of aronia > blackcurrant > blueberry > seomoktae > seoritae > black rice. These results indicated that seomoktae and aronia possessed the high level of functional components and further study will be needed to develop high value-added foods based on the colored agricultural products.
